#aaa9de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#aaa9de is composed of 66.7% red, 66.3% green and 87.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 23.4% cyan, 23.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 12.9% black. It has a hue angle of 241.1 degrees, a saturation of 44.5% and a lightness of 76.7%. #aaa9de color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#5553bd. Closest websafe color is: #9999cc.

#aaa9de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#aaa9de has RGB values of R:170, G:169, B:222 and CMYK values of C:0.23, M:0.24, Y:0,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 11184606.

Shades and Tints of #aaa9de

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#05050d is the darkest color, while #fefeff is the lightest one.
